Position Summary: Bend Dermatology Clinic is seeking and Advanced Aesthetician to work part time in our Bend OR location. The Advanced Aesthetician is a licensed skincare professional responsible for delivering high-quality, personalized aesthetic treatments and procedures. This role requires advanced knowledge of skincare science, cutting-edge technologies, and a strong understanding of patient care. The Advanced Aesthetician performs a range of services including but not limited to advanced facials, chemical peels, microdermabrasion, laser treatments, microneedling, and other non-invasive cosmetic procedures.
Additionally, the Advanced Aesthetician provides expert consultation, assesses individual skin conditions, develops customized treatment plans, and educates patients on proper skincare routines and products. This position demands a high level of professionalism, attention to detail, and a commitment to maintaining the highest standards of safety, compliance, sanitation, and patient confidentiality. The ideal candidate is passionate about skincare, continuously stays up to date with the latest trends and technologies in aesthetics, and excels in delivering exceptional customer service.
